查看: 5306|回复: 6|关注: 0

[已解决] 如何实现图片的批量读取,001 002 003 004.处理,再批量存.....

[复制链接]

新手

7 麦片

财富积分


050


8

主题

29

帖子

0

最佳答案
  • 关注者: 1
本帖最后由 869278062 于 2016-11-5 12:07 编辑

for index_j=1:100
     for index_i=1:6
       image_first='.jpg';   
         image_name=strcat(int2str(index_j),'_r_850_0',int2str(index_i),image_first);
         I1=imread(image_name);
    end
end


蓝线处怎么理

到100

到100
回复主题 已获打赏: 0 积分

举报

MATLAB 基础讨论
版块优秀回答者

入门

93 麦片

财富积分


50500


5

主题

288

帖子

17

最佳答案
  • 关注者: 1
发表于 2016-11-5 12:20:30 | 显示全部楼层
报错信息看一下
回复此楼 已获打赏: 0 积分

举报

新手

7 麦片

财富积分


050


8

主题

29

帖子

0

最佳答案
  • 关注者: 1
 楼主| 发表于 2016-11-5 18:40:59 | 显示全部楼层

没有错误   就是开始的001  002  003..............  怎么显示出来  只能显示1 2 3 4.....
回复此楼 已获打赏: 0 积分

举报

MATLAB 基础讨论
版块优秀回答者

入门

93 麦片

财富积分


50500


5

主题

288

帖子

17

最佳答案
  • 关注者: 1
发表于 2016-11-6 20:25:37 | 显示全部楼层
869278062 发表于 2016-11-5 18:40
没有错误   就是开始的001  002  003..............  怎么显示出来  只能显示1 2 3 4.....  ...

那是因为你得index_j本来就是1 2 3啊。。。
回复此楼 已获打赏: 0 积分

举报

新手

7 麦片

财富积分


050


8

主题

29

帖子

0

最佳答案
  • 关注者: 1
 楼主| 发表于 2016-11-7 20:03:15 | 显示全部楼层
killerzheng 发表于 2016-11-6 20:25
那是因为你得index_j本来就是1 2 3啊。。。

我是想在蓝线处如何改才能实现 001  002 003 ....
回复此楼 已获打赏: 0 积分

举报

MATLAB 基础讨论
版块优秀回答者

入门

93 麦片

财富积分


50500


5

主题

288

帖子

17

最佳答案
  • 关注者: 1
发表于 2016-11-8 19:40:47 | 显示全部楼层 |此回复为最佳答案
869278062 发表于 2016-11-7 20:03
我是想在蓝线处如何改才能实现 001  002 003 ....

 image_name=strcat(num2str(index_j,'%03d'),'_r_850_0',int2str(index_i),image_first);
回复此楼 已获打赏: 0 积分

举报

新手

7 麦片

财富积分


050


8

主题

29

帖子

0

最佳答案
  • 关注者: 1
 楼主| 发表于 2017-2-15 17:45:56 | 显示全部楼层
killerzheng 发表于 2016-11-8 19:40
 image_name=strcat(num2str(index_j,'%03d'),'_r_850_0',int2str(index_i),image_first);

谢谢   之前解决了
回复此楼 已获打赏: 0 积分

举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

站长推荐上一条 /3 下一条

快速回复 返回顶部 返回列表